What Are the Top Exterior Renovation Materials for Florida Homes?

Your home’s exterior is its first line of defense against Florida’s unique climate challenges. Choosing the right siding, roofing, windows, and paint is crucial for both curb appeal and long-term protection.

How Does Fiber Cement Siding Perform in Florida’s Humid and Hurricane-Prone Climate?

Fiber cement siding is a powerhouse against moisture, termites, and high winds. Made from a blend of cement, sand, and cellulose fibers, it meets Miami-Dade’s stringent hurricane standards.

  • Pros: Outstanding moisture and rot resistanceClass A fire rating and termite deterrenceHolds up under heat and UV exposure
  • Cons: Higher installation costsHeavier panels need reinforced framingRequires repainting every 10–15 years

Fiber cement’s durability makes it a top contender, especially when compared to lighter siding options.

Why Is Stucco a Popular Exterior Finish in Florida?

Stucco, made from cement, lime, sand, and additives, is applied in layers to create a seamless, breathable wall system that reflects heat and resists moisture.

Stucco shines in tropical climates for several reasons:

  • UV and Heat Reflection – Its light color and texture reduce solar heat gain.
  • Seamless Barrier – Continuous layers prevent water intrusion and algae growth.
  • Wind Loads – Engineered systems meet hurricane-force resistance codes.

This low-maintenance finish naturally leads us to explore roofing options designed for similar performance.

How Do Metal and Tile Roofing Materials Compare for Hurricane Resistance and Heat Reflection?

Close-up of metal and tile roofing materials showcasing textures and colors suitable for hurricane resistance

Roofing materials must handle uplift forces, reflect solar radiation, and prevent leaks. Here’s how metal panels stack up against clay or concrete tiles:

EntityAttributeMetal RoofingTile Roofing
HurricaneWind RatingUp to 160 mph with proper anchoringUp to 140 mph with interlocking systems
Heat ReflectionSolar Reflectance Index20–70 depending on finish35–55 for light-colored or coated tiles
LifespanYears40–70 years50–100 years
MaintenanceTasksOccasional resealing around fastenersPeriodic tile replacement and inspections

Metal’s lightweight panels and high reflectivity offer quick installation and energy savings, while tile’s mass and thermal inertia provide long-term insulation and classic aesthetics. Understanding these trade-offs helps you choose the best rain-shedding system for Florida’s heat and hurricanes.

What Role Do Impact Windows and Doors Play in Florida Home Renovations?

Impact-rated windows and doors feature laminated glass and reinforced frames to withstand windborne debris, reduce noise, and improve thermal performance. They also support hurricane compliance and can lower insurance premiums.

  • Storm Protection and Debris Shielding
  • Up to 30% Reduction in Cooling Loads
  • Improved Acoustic Insulation
  • Insurance Premium Discounts of 5–15%

Impact systems enhance safety and energy efficiency, setting the stage for protective exterior coatings like UV-resistant paints.

How Does Exterior Paint Affect Durability Against Florida’s Sun and Humidity?

High-performance exterior paints use elastomeric binders, UV inhibitors, and moisture-blocking pigments to seal surfaces and reflect solar energy. Key paint choices include:

  • Acrylic Elastomeric Coatings – Bridge minor cracks and resist water intrusion.
  • Silicone-Modified Siloxane – Enhance breathability while repelling water.
  • Ceramic-Infused Finishes – Boost IR reflection for cooler walls.

Choosing specialized coatings can extend the lifespan of siding and stucco by up to 20%, reinforcing exterior systems against thermal stress and moisture cycles.

Which Structural Materials and Foundations Are Best Suited for Florida Homes?

Foundation systems and framing materials are crucial for resilience against shifting soils, flooding, and wind load. The best choices combine moisture resistance, structural integrity, and energy performance.

What Are the Advantages of Concrete Block vs. Wood Frame Construction in Florida?

Concrete block walls and wood frame assemblies each offer unique structural benefits.

How Do Insulated Concrete Forms (ICF) Improve Energy Efficiency and Storm Protection?

ICF assemblies combine interlocking foam panels and reinforced concrete cores to form a continuous thermal envelope and load-bearing wall. They deliver:

  • R-Values of R-20 to R-40
  • Airtight construction reducing infiltration by 60%
  • 200 mph wind resistance when reinforced
  • Continuous insulation with no thermal bridging

The synergy of mass and foam reduces heating, cooling costs, and hurricane vulnerability, transitioning into foundation options suited for Florida’s soils.

What Foundation Types Are Recommended for Florida’s Soil and Climate Conditions?

Florida’s clay and sandy soils require slab-on-grade or pier foundations to manage moisture and uplift. Common systems include:

  • Monolithic Slab – Poured concrete slab and footing in one pour, ideal for flat lots.
  • Stem Wall over Pier – Elevates the slab above grade, improving ventilation and flood resistance.
  • Crawl Space on Piers – Provides access to services and reduces moisture contact.

Choosing the right foundation balances soil conditions, flood regulations, and energy performance, leading naturally to interior material considerations.

What Are the Benefits of Mold-Resistant Drywall and Interior Finishes in Florida?

Mold-resistant gypsum boards and moisture-inhibiting paints protect walls and ceilings from fungal growth. Primary benefits include:

  • Reduced spore proliferation in humid rooms
  • Improved indoor air quality and occupant health
  • Extended finish lifespan in bathrooms and kitchens

These materials complete a moisture-managed interior ecosystem that aligns with resilient exterior and structural choices.

How Does Material Durability Affect Maintenance Costs and Lifespan in Florida?

Long-life materials reduce repair cycles and labor expenses. Durable options typically:

  • Extend repainting intervals by 50% (e.g., acrylic vs. standard paint)
  • Withstand storm damage and avoid emergency patching
  • Lower pest repair costs through rot-proof composites

Evaluating lifecycle costs clarifies the true value proposition of higher-grade finishes.

Can Hurricane-Resistant Materials Lower Home Insurance Premiums in Florida?

Insurers reward risk mitigation through discounts on windstorm and hail coverage. Typical savings include:

  • Concrete Block Walls – 5–20% premium reduction
  • Impact-Rated Openings – 15–25% discount for windows and doors
  • Metal Roofing – 5–15% credit for wind-rated panels

What Is the Return on Investment (ROI) for Using High-Quality Renovation Materials in Florida?

High-performance materials can boost resale value and curb appeal while lowering operating costs. Average ROI estimates:

  • Fiber cement siding: 65–75%
  • Metal roofing: 70–85%
  • Impact windows and doors: 55–75%
  • Energy-efficient insulation and radiant barriers: 80–110%

Investing in resilient, efficient systems delivers both market value and ongoing savings, closing the analysis cycle before exploring sustainable alternatives.

What Local Building Codes Support Sustainable Renovation Practices in Florida?

Florida’s Building Code and green standards encourage:

  • Florida Green Building Coalition (FGBC) guidelines for water and energy efficiency
  • Miami-Dade High-Velocity Hurricane Zone (HVHZ) requirements for storm-resistant assemblies
  • FEMA floodplain regulations for elevated foundations and flood-resistant finishes

Compliance with these codes ensures both resilience and certification that enhances property value.
